A Bolgheri, our Merlot in purity expresses intensity and generosity. The deep and impenetrable colour creates an intriguing expectation expressed by the ripe dark fruit together with the rich, enveloping and full palate.

Appellation: Controlled Designation of Origin
Town of production: Castagneto Carducci (Livorno)
Grapes: 100% Merlot
Alcohol: 14.5% by vol.
Yield in litres / hectare: 6000 litre/ha.
Growing method: Spur pruning (Cordon)
Harvest period: From the second ten days of September.
Release: December of the following two years after the harvest.
Alcoholic Fermentation and Maceration: The destemmed grapes are not pressed in order to respect the integrity of the skins. During the fermentation, the “punch-down” process is frequently carried out to facilitate the extraction of aromas, colour and tannins from the grape marcs. Once the maceration is done, after 8 to 12 days, we draw off the wine.
Malolactic fermentation and aging: After being drawn off, the wine is decanted and prepared for the malolactic fermentation which lasts about 10 days and takes place at a temperature of 20°C. The “Rosso Bolgheri DOC is aged in 500-litre oak barrels; before release, it spends 6 months in the bottle.
